Active Learning Strategies and Student Engagement (Online, Zoom)
WorkshopWednesday, March 4, 2026 , 10:00 AM - 11:30 AMThis interactive workshop introduces practical strategies to enhance student engagement in both virtual and in-person classrooms. Participants will explore key dimensions of student engagement—behavioural, emotional, and cognitive—and examine common challenges, including low participation, low motivation, and classroom distractions. Through hands-on activities using tools like Padlet, Mentimeter, polls, breakout rooms, and whiteboards, attendees will experience active learning techniques they can immediately apply. The session also highlights student-centred teaching approaches, effective communication practices, and classroom management strategies that foster meaningful learning. Participants will leave with concrete, evidence-informed ideas to boost engagement and support student success.Active Learning Strategies and Student Engagement (Online, Zoom)

Blackboard Gradebook (Online, Zoom)
WorkshopTuesday, January 27, 2026 , 12:00 PM - 01:00 PMMany use weighted grades as outlined in your course syllabus. Some keep spreadsheets to calculate the final grade, some work hard to ensure that this assignment is out of 25 or 16 or any other specific number. You can set that weighting up in Gradebook. But what about if you are calculating participation in class… You can do that in Gradebook too. Come and learn ways that you can set your Gradebook up so that you and your students know what their grades are.Blackboard Test Integrity (Online, Zoom)
